There has been a change in plans for those heading to Beaver Stadium for the Blue-White Practice on Saturday. The event will now start at 12:15 p.m., with the autograph session now taking place following the practice rather than before. The change was made due to the threat of inclement weather.
Below are key details for visitors, per the Penn State Athletic Department:
Parking lots will open at 8 a.m. Club, Letterman/ADA, Museum/ADA and suite entrances will open at 9 a.m. Gates A, B, C & E will open for
the public at 11 a.m.
Fan seating will be available in the north, south and east lower bowl areas of the stadium. No west side seating will be available, and upper north and upper south sections will not be open.

Game Day Traffic
- Fans traveling to Blue-White Practice on April 25 should be aware of active construction projects that will result in road closures and detours in the State College area.
- Penn State Athletics encourages all attendees to review the information below and plan accordingly.
- Route 322 (Innovation Park/Penn State Exit): Westbound drivers will be detoured via I-99 northbound to the Shiloh Road Exit 76, then back southbound to the Innovation Park exit (Exit 74), or via I-99 southbound to the Woodycrest-Toftrees Exit 71, then back northbound to the Innovation Park exit (Exit 73).
- I-80 Exit 161 Westbound (Bellefonte): The I-80 westbound off-ramp at Exit 161 is closed as part of the I-80/I-99 interchange project. Drivers should continue to Exit 158 at Milesburg, then take I-80 eastbound back to the Bellefonte exit.
- No game day traffic pattern will be in effect. Fans can visit 511PA.com for the latest travel conditions and follow @Beaver_Stadium on X for real-time updates.
